Begin forwarded message: From: Matthew Posik <posik@temple.edu> Subject: EXT: Angular Resolution Workfest contribution Date: December 11, 2024 at 10:06:29 AM EST To: "zxu22@kent.edu" <zxu22@kent.edu>, "syano@hiroshima-u.ac.jp" <syano@hiroshima-u.ac.jp> Hi Zhangbu and Satoshi, As you may know we are planning on holding an angular resolution session at the upcoming ePIC collaboration meeting in January. The session is scheduled for Thursday Jan. 23rd 9:00-13:00 Rome time. The goal of this session is to assess what has been done in estimating the angular resolutions of tracks entering the PID detectors and define a plan on how to converge on final set of values. Given your DSC's activity in assessing the angular resolutions via fitting hits in the outer tracking sensitive layers, I would like to invite your DSC to present a contribution during this session. The time slot for the contribution is 20 mins and should cover the technical details of how the angular resolutions are estimated and what their results are. There will be plenty of time in the session for questions and discussions. I will leave it to you to decide who from your DSC would be best to present this contribution.
